The Los Angeles Lakers will look to halt a three-game losing streak against the Golden State Warriors on Saturday night.

It will be the third meeting of the season between the teams. The Warriors won the first meeting, but the Lakers came out victorious in the most recent matchup earlier this month. Whoever wins on Saturday night will take the edge in the season series.

LeBron James will play vs. Warriors on Saturday night

When it comes to LeBron James’ status for the game, the star forward isn’t listed on the official injury report, so he’ll be available to play.

So far this season, James has played in 40 games for the Lakers and posted averages of 21.5 points, 7.0 assists, 5.7 rebounds and 1.1 steals per performance.

But while James will be available, Warriors star guard Steph Curry won’t be. Curry has been ruled out of the game due to a nagging knee injury that has kept him sidelined for the entire month of February. So, fans unfortunately won’t get an opportunity to see two all-time greats go head-to-head.

The Lakers and Warriors are scheduled to meet again in April. Hopefully both James and Curry will be available for that one.
